We had dinner here last night with our kids and some friends (party of 8), and it was our first…read moretime visiting. Even though the restaurant is small and busy, we were seated right away, which was a great start. Our waiter Washington, was fantastic, friendly, attentive, and made our whole experience even better. The atmosphere was perfect too. They had music playing at just the right volume and a big TV showing the live Dodger game, which the kids loved. We started with chips and salsa. The salsa had the perfect level of spice for everyone at the table. The kids ordered horchatas and were excited about the unlimited refills (something you don't always see at other restaurants!). The drinks for the adults were just as impressive. My wife's watermelon margarita on the rocks was perfectly made. It was not overly sweet or syrupy like at some places. Our friends had the "El Jefe" margaritas, and they definitely didn't skimp on the tequila! For dinner, everything was a hit. The kids loved their meals. Albóndigas soup, shrimp tacos, and street tacos--all served with rice and beans. The adult dishes were just as good. The carne asada arrachera was cooked perfectly, the chile verde was full of flavor, and my chicken mole was delicious with a great balance of spicy and sweet without being overwhelming. The portions were very generous, and everything came with rice, beans, and both corn and flour tortillas. The only small thing I would've preferred differently was the chicken in my mole. I personally would've liked a leg and thigh instead of sliced chicken breast but the dish was still very good overall. What really stood out was the hospitality. At the end of the meal, Washington offered us "holy water"-house tequila shots on the house--and it wasn't cheap tequila either! Then after the bill came, he surprised us again with another round of "holy water". That level of generosity and care really impressed us. We also learned that the restaurant has been there 20+ years and is family-run by him and his siblings, which made the experience feel even more personal. You can tell they have a loyal customer base--one couple even said, "See you tomorrow Washington!" The only feedback we'd offer (coming from a customer service background) is that we noticed a few guests waiting at the entrance without being greeted, and one couple actually left the restaurant. A simple "Welcome, we'll be right with you" would go a long way. That said, it didn't take away from our experience. Overall, amazing food, great service, generous portions, and a welcoming family atmosphere. We will definitely be back to try more of their menu!

I went on a taco run yesterday to try to find the best taco in Whittier…read more Started off the run with a keto taco mixed with asada and al pastor and then a regular tripa taco. Keto taco - toasted/grilled cheese instead of a regular tortilla - needed to be done a little more on one side as the cheese wasn't quite toasty enough to stay in place to slightly resemble the shape of a taco. Bit hard to eat, covered my hands in grease. Asada tastes almost boiled, and this being my 2nd or 3rd time getting the Asada here, it consistently tastes like it was boiled and not grilled. Unsure of meat quality or preparation, but there are no grill marks and it's a bit chewy. Same with the al pastor. Tripa taco was bizarre. Strips of flat skin instead of the usual roundish, cylindrical shape of tripa (intestine). Usually a saltier, fattier meat than asada, which is my preference but the one here was lacking in flavor and the texture threw me off a bit. Tripa can be chewy - unless requested extra done, which is how I normally order it - but there was no saving this tripa. I think it needs to be sliced differently, the cuts made it inedible. Brother shared some of his chorizo taco and it was the better of the bunch. Red chorizo, TJ style, although it was also lacking a teeny bit in flavor... onions and cilantro to the rescue! Still, mediocre. Salsas were ok, nothing out of the ordinary. Don't think the tortillas were homemade. Service was fine, cashier takes your order, dude at the counter was chill and had a friendly attitude. Seating was limited. Mostly bar style seating but the majority was in front of a window and it had so much heat trapped from the glass that it was kind of uncomfortable. Other seats are too close to the bathroom. Good for a quick bite or just pick-up orders. Wouldn't plan a sit down/dine-in visit. Parking is scarce and has really small spots, wouldn't come if you're driving a pick-up truck or anything like that. Food was reasonably priced, which is good, however; the food was lacking so I would not return.
